top of page

The Shift from Data Warehouse to Data Lakehouse: A Strategic Overview

Updated: Dec 19, 2025

Data is the backbone of modern business decisions. For years, organizations have relied on data warehouses to store and analyze structured data. Yet, as data types and volumes grow, and AI demands increase, many leaders face a critical question: Is the traditional data warehouse enough? The answer often points to a new architecture—the data lakehouse.


This post explains what data warehouses and data lakehouses are, why the lakehouse emerged, and what it means to modernize your data platform. It offers a strategic overview for business leaders considering this shift, focusing on data infrastructure, platform evolution, migration, and architectural redesign. You will also find practical use cases and an executive checklist to guide your decision.


Key Components of This Post


  1. What a Data Warehouse, Data Lake, and Data Lakehouse Actually Are

  2. Why the Lakehouse Architecture Emerged

  3. Is a Data Lakehouse Ideal for Your Organization?

  4. Practical Use Cases and a Decision Checklist


1. Definitions & Foundations


1.1 What Is a Data Warehouse?


A data warehouse is a centralized repository designed to store structured data from multiple sources. It organizes data into tables and schemas optimized for reporting and business intelligence. Data warehouses have been the standard for decades, supporting consistent, reliable analytics for finance, sales, and operations.


Key characteristics of data warehouses:

  • Store structured, cleaned, and processed data

  • Use schema-on-write, meaning data is transformed before storage

  • Support SQL queries and reporting tools like BI (charts, KPIs, dashboards)

  • Typically run on dedicated hardware or cloud services


A data warehouse is a centralized repository designed to store structured data from multiple sources. It organizes data into tables and schemas optimized for reporting and business intelligence. Data warehouses have been the standard for decades, supporting consistent, reliable analytics for finance, sales, and operations.

While data warehouses excel at handling structured data, they struggle with the growing variety and volume of unstructured or semi-structured data, such as logs, images, videos, or sensor data. This limitation led to the rise of data lakes.


1.2 What Is a Data Lake?


A data lake is a centralized repository built to store structured, semi-structured, and unstructured data from multiple sources. This flexibility supports modern analytics, machine learning, and real-time use cases as data volumes and data types continue to expand. Data lakes emerged as organizations needed to capture high-velocity streaming data, logs, clickstreams, IoT feeds, images, documents, and other formats.


Key characteristics of data lakes:

  • Store raw, unprocessed data in open, scalable storage

  • Use schema-on-read, meaning data is ingested first and transformed later

  • Support all data types: structured (tables), semi-structured (JSON, XML), and unstructured (audio, video, text)

  • Designed for advanced analytics, data science, and machine learning workloads

  • Built on low-cost, cloud-based object storage (e.g., Azure Data Lake Storage, S3, GCS)


A data lake is a centralized repository built to store structured, semi-structured, and unstructured data from multiple sources. This flexibility supports modern analytics, machine learning, and real-time use cases as data volumes and data types continue to expand. Data lakes emerged as organizations needed to capture high-velocity streaming data, logs, clickstreams, IoT feeds, images, documents, and other formats.

While data lakes provide massive scalability and flexibility, they also introduce challenges. Without proper governance and data management practices, they can devolve into “data swamps”—repositories with unclear data quality, inconsistent structure, and limited usability.


These issues set the stage for the evolution of the data lakehouse, which adds governance, reliability, and performance on top of a lake foundation.


1.3 What Is a Data Lakehouse?


A data lakehouse combines the best features of data lakes and data warehouses. It supports storing all types of data—structured, semi-structured, and unstructured—in a single platform. Unlike traditional data lakes, which often lack governance and performance, lakehouses add management, reliability, and performance layers.


Core features of data lakehouses:

  • Store raw and processed data in open file formats

  • Support schema-on-read and schema-on-write flexibility

  • Provide ACID transactions for data reliability

  • Enable BI and AI workloads on the same platform

  • Run on scalable cloud infrastructure


A data lakehouse combines the best features of data lakes and data warehouses. It supports storing all types of data—structured, semi-structured, and unstructured—in a single platform. Unlike traditional data lakes, which often lack governance and performance, lakehouses add management, reliability, and performance layers.

Lakehouses allow organizations to unify data storage and analytics, reducing complexity and cost while supporting advanced AI and machine learning initiatives.


2. Why Did the Lakehouse Architecture Emerge?


The lakehouse architecture emerged to address the limitations of both data warehouses and data lakes:


  • Data warehouses are expensive and rigid, designed primarily for structured data and traditional BI.

  • Data lakes offer flexibility and scale but often lack data quality controls, governance, and performance needed for enterprise use.


As AI and machine learning became critical, organizations needed a platform that could handle diverse data types, support real-time processing, and maintain data integrity. The lakehouse meets these needs by combining the openness and scalability of data lakes with the management and performance of data warehouses.


This architecture supports faster innovation, reduces data silos, and simplifies data management, making it a strategic choice for modern enterprises.


The lakehouse architecture emerged to address the limitations of both data warehouses and data lakes:







Data warehouses are expensive and rigid, designed primarily for structured data and traditional BI.



Data lakes offer flexibility and scale but often lack data quality controls, governance, and performance needed for enterprise use.



As AI and machine learning became critical, organizations needed a platform that could handle diverse data types, support real-time processing, and maintain data integrity. The lakehouse meets these needs by combining the openness and scalability of data lakes with the management and performance of data warehouses.

3. Is a Data Lakehouse Ideal for Your Organization?


How do you know if a data lakehouse is right for your organization? Let's examine the business outcomes, practical use cases, and key indicators that signal whether this architecture is the best move for your enterprise.


3.1 Business Outcomes with a Data Lakehouse


  • One data foundation — Fewer tools, fewer handoffs, reduced friction.

  • Faster insights — Streaming + real-time analytics = quicker decisions.

  • AI readiness — Data unified for model training and AI copilots.

  • Lower TCO — Cheaper storage + less data duplication.

  • Stronger governance — Single security and quality framework.


3.2 Example Use Cases for a Lakehouse Platform


  • Customer 360 Analytics: Combine structured CRM data with unstructured social media and interaction logs to get a complete view of customer behavior for customer intelligence and churn prediction.

  • Supply Chain Optimization: Integrate logistics data, weather forecasts, and inventory levels to improve delivery accuracy, reduce costs, and enable real-time inventory and demand forecasting.

  • Real-Time Fraud Detection: Ingest streaming transaction data alongside historical records to identify anomalies and suspicious patterns for real-time fraud detection.

  • Product Quality Monitoring: Analyze sensor data from manufacturing equipment with historical defect reports to predict failures.

  • Personalized Marketing Campaigns: Use clickstream data, purchase history, and demographic information to tailor offers dynamically.


3.3 Ideal If Your Organization Is:


  • Looking to operationalize AI/ML use cases.

  • Managing multi-format or high-volume data.

  • Needing real-time or near real-time decision intelligence.

  • Seeking to consolidate fragmented data tools and pipelines.

  • Pursuing cost efficiency in storage and compute.

  • Preparing workforce adoption of AI copilots and automation.


3.4 Decision Checklist for Data Lakehouse Transformation


3.4.1 Business & Strategy Alignment

  • Have we defined the business outcomes this transformation must enable?

  • Do we need AI/ML, AI copilots, or agent-based automation for decision-making or operations?

  • Will real-time insights or streaming analytics meaningfully improve decisions?


3.4.2 Current Platform Limitations

  • Is our current warehouse struggling with scale, cost, or performance?

  • Does our current data warehouse support all data types and AI workloads we need?

  • Is governance, security, or compliance fragmented across tools?


3.4.3 Data Landscape & Use Cases

  • Is our data spread across multiple systems, formats, or domains?

  • Does our data team spend too much time cleaning, preparing, or moving data?

  • Are reporting cycles slow, manual, or dependent on multiple handoffs?

  • Are business teams asking for self-service analytics?


3.4.4 Cost, Scale & Architecture

  • Do we need to scale storage and compute independently to control costs?

  • Are we prepared to invest in modernizing our data infrastructure?


3.4.5 Organizational Readiness

  • Is our team ready to adopt new tools, skills, and operational models?

  • Do we have a phased migration plan to minimize risk and disruption?


Answering these questions helps clarify whether a lakehouse transformation aligns with your strategic goals. If five or more statements are true, a Data Lakehouse is likely a strategic fit.


Conclusion


The shift from data warehouse to data lakehouse is more than a technology upgrade. It is a strategic move to build a flexible, scalable data platform that supports AI and advanced analytics.


By understanding the strengths of each architecture and evaluating both readiness and business need, organizations can position themselves for future success.


About MegaminxX


At MegaminxX, we design and implement modern, unified data foundations with Microsoft Fabric and Databricks — delivering scalable architectures and enterprise-grade BI/AI/ML capabilities. Our tailored services include building actionable business intelligence, predictive insights, and prescriptive analytics that drive ROI.


We bring a structured approach to platform selection and use case prioritization — using practical frameworks and assessments across critical business dimensions — with a focus on accelerating sustainable business growth.


Access our resources to evaluate solutions:


Get in Touch:

About the Author

Neena Singhal is the founder of MegaminxX, leading Business Transformation with Data, AI & Automation.

 
 
bottom of page